The founding of Toronto For ten thousand years the natives lived on the site of the city of Toronto, being the beginning of their history. The first European to arrive in the area was a Frenchman named Etienne Brule in 1615. However, the first European settlement was a French trading fort called Fort Rouille, built in 1750.
